A Vision Beyond Religion: What Bahá’ís Believe

Oneness of humanity as the foundation for peace.

Equality of women and men as a divine principle.

Religion as a force for unity, not division.

For those disillusioned by conflict and sectarianism, these beliefs offer not theory, but a practical blueprint for reconciliation.

What Bahá’ís Do

Grassroots community building in neighborhoods worldwide.

Educational programs fostering moral and intellectual growth.

Social action projects addressing justice and sustainability.

Where words fall short, action speaks—bringing unity and service into everyday life.
